He is currently out-producing those two guys with high potential. Personally, I would trade Gorman because I don't believe he will ever be productive enough. But productive as he may be, Burly is a lineup problem. He is a .289 hitter with .457 slugging and plays positions that require a lot more power. As someone said previously, he is short on tools. he is an overachiever. He is a 3-tool player. 3-tool players are contributors, not cornerstones.

The Cards have a surplus of 3-toolers right now. Because Burly is actually performing, he may bring back in trade the kind of young plyaer the Cards really need. that said, I wouldn't coplain if they signed him to 4/$36M.

Burly needs to be able to maintain a +.800 OPS to have good value. Can he do that for a season with Busch stadium as his home ballpark?
Remains to be seen, but when he's not hitting, he's a negative value to a team because of his lack of other plus tools.
Cards shutout out in 5 of the last 7 games when Burly starts.
Burly's bWAR has been hanging around +1.0 for a while now, but he did have a great June as his net WAR for the other months this year are negative.
He's ok, and better currently than either Walker and Gorman.
Still, I'd strive to have starters that have a decent chance to be at least +3 bWAR guys for a season.
For Burly, he'd need about 3 hot June type months every season, or become more consistent every month to ever sniff a +3 type season. June gives us hope that maybe he could do that moving forward.
I'd strive to have more complete type position starters that can provide value even when they're not hot with the bat.
If Herrera can learn to play LF decently by next year, maybe the DH opens up for Burly. That said, I'd often be exploring what Burly's trade market looks like.
